Pertemps is currently recruiting an experienced Tribunal Officer to support Surrey County Council within their SEND service.

The Role

You will lead and deliver the local authority service responsible for the identification, analysis, case management and review of children and young people with Special Educational Needs (SEN) who are at risk of, or currently involved in, appeals with the Special Educational Needs and Disability Tribunal (SENDIST). The role includes representing Surrey County Council at tribunal hearings where required.

You will manage a complex and growing caseload of approximately 145–150 tribunal cases per year, with annual increases of around 5–7%, requiring strong organisation, legal understanding and collaborative working.
